I am not sure what I have here: I was playing with EquityOption.cpp in the Examples directory, and realized even if I change the evaluationDate, the option prices do not change. Changing the settlementDate indeed influences the option price as expected.
Now, with the assumption that my observation above is correct, shouldn't there be a discounting logic as a function of the duration between the settlementDate and the evaluationDate?
Before I look into the code, if someone could quickly confirm or explain the observation, that would be great. Thank you.
